**Mgmt Meeting Minutes — Retiring the Brightline Range**

Quick recap for sales leads at Fenholt Supplies: we agreed to retire the Brightline fixture range by year-end. Remaining stock moves to clearance pricing next month, and accounts on standing orders get migrated to the Lumetta range. Trade-in incentives were approved in principle. The confidential note on next steps sits just below.

board note of bajof-bajeg: The pricing group signed off on a budget of $13.4 million for Project Sildor. The renewal with Lamixek Holdings closes at $48.9 million a year, 49 percent above the last contract.

## Service Accounts

The driver-assignment heuristic (Routeweave) runs under a dedicated service account rather than any individual's credentials. This account has read access to the dispatch queue and write access to assignment records only — it cannot modify driver profiles. As a new contractor, request access through your team lead, then configure your local environment before running the simulator. The service key for the staging account appears below.

gateway credential: kto23_dolYgAScEh2TaPOlStqOl98

Changelog 4.2.1 — Murmurloft service. Renamed LOG_SAMPLE_PCT to LOG_SAMPLE_RATE to match the rest of the Hollowbeam fleet; the old name is ignored as of this release. Default remains 0.05 to keep the chatty request logger manageable. Support: customers upgrading must update their env files or sampling silently drops to zero. The service also ships samples to the central sink, and the next line sets that credential.

secret setting of yafof-tawep: RELAY_SECRET8=8abb5772

## Runbook: KeyMill rotation run

KeyMill rotates internal secrets every 14 days. Reviewers should confirm that each rotation writes an immutable audit row before the old secret is revoked, and that rollback entries are paired. The audit ledger lives in a dedicated database, which KeyMill reaches via the connection string below.

replica DSN, yaweg-badup: clickhouse://gorwyn_svc:M6@db-090e.urlaqio.local:5432/quenox

Handover — Marla to Deniz, night shift, Kestrelworks Depot. Bike cage latch on the east side sticks; lift and push, don't force it. Parking gates on Arbor Lane are on manual until the motor part arrives Thursday. Chain the inner gate at 23:00, log it in the gate book. If the reader at the cage flashes red twice, use the override pass below.

staff pass of kawip-hawef = bdg-QLP-2